Figurine of the God Bes

December 25, 2022 By admin Leave a Comment

Bes is an ancient Egyptian god associated with protection, fertility, and childbirth. He is often depicted as a dwarf-like figure with a lion or leopard skin, a beard, and a broad, flat nose. Bes is typically shown with a variety of symbols of protection, such as knives, shields, and musical instruments.

Figurines of Bes were commonly placed in homes and tombs as a way to invoke his protection and bring good luck. In ancient Egyptian mythology, Bes was believed to be a powerful protector of children and pregnant women, and was also associated with music and dance.

Bes was a popular god in ancient Egypt, and his image can be found on a variety of objects, including jewelry, amulets, and temple decorations. Figurines of Bes were often made of precious materials such as gold, silver, and bronze, and were prized for their beauty and spiritual significance.

Today, figurines of Bes are popular collectors’ items and are often displayed as decorative objects. They are also used in modern spiritual practices as a way to invoke the protection and blessings of the ancient Egyptian god.
